ABC/INOAC SYSTEMS LLC Robotic Paint Process Technician in Fremont, Ohio
*JOB TITLE: Robotic Paint Process Technician *
*DEPARTMENT: Paint Dept. *
*REPORTS TO: Paint Manager *
PRIMARY FUNCTION: Assure all equipment is operational and operating correctly in order to assure that safety, quality, and utilization are achieved to the highest standards of acceptance.
R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Assure all Fluid Delivery / Mixers are following rules and regulations in regards to safety and company policy.
- Develop, teach, and train team members to excel in any position. (Cross-training).
- Do booth checks to assure robots are not causing defects.
- Proficient in troubleshooting
- General understanding of the Washer System.
- Assist with downtime reduction activities such as jam ups.
- Write Robotic programs and color setups.
- Assure parts are entered correctly into the MIS station.
- Verify all robotic / fluid delivery equipment is operating properly and correct problems quickly and efficiently.
- Understand quality standards and provide feedback to sprayers/fluid delivery/mixers if there is a problem.
- Follow through and contain any trails for Process/Product Improvement that need to be completed.
- Complete reporting in a timely manner.
- Develop paint/process improvements and implement.
- Understanding of how and when to make changes to presets, shaping air, atomization air, and KV.
- Provide support with Continuous Improvement Team activities.
- Participate in formal improvement team activities.
- Support all departmental and organizational improvement initiatives in order to achieve business objectives.
- 90% of time will be on the shop floor related.
- Participate in IATF 16949-2016/ ISO 14001 activities or any other organizational certifications as needed
- Other activities as assigned by Management.

- Understand Specific Paint Related Safety Concerns.
- All opened containers being used must be grounded.
- Secondary container labels must be used to identify any chemical/paint not in its original container
- Proper Paint Waste Collection and Disposal must be followed.
